Abeona Therapeutics develops gene and cell therapies for rare diseases. Its lead product, ZEVASKYN, is an FDA-approved therapy for recessive dystrophic epidermolysis bullosa (RDEB), a severe and life-threatening genetic skin disorder.
Read more on ABEO →Equinor is a Norway-based integrated oil and gas company. It has been publicly listed since 2001, but the government retains a 67% stake. Operating primarily on the Norwegian Continental Shelf, the firm produced 2.1 million barrels of oil equivalent per day in 2021 (52% oil) and ended the year with 5.4 billion barrels of proven reserves (49% oil). Operations also include offshore wind, solar, oil refineries and natural gas processing, marketing, and trading.
